Yesterday I noticed that mock/yum seem to be having trouble finding pathname-based buildreqs.
For example, buildreqs of /usr/include/tcpd.h and /usr/include/pcap.h aren't getting found. I use these to maintain spec compatibility across various releases, where these files can be found in either tcp_wrappers or tcp_wrappers-devel, or libpcap or libpcap-devel packages respectively. I've tried upgrading to mock 0.8.15 from CVS (F-8 branch) and it hasn't helped. Is this intentional behaviour (not getting/reading the filelists metadata) for speed purposes?
